All of a sudden I'm having issues installing apps through Managed Play on isolated devices. When navigating to the app directly I can see "This item isn't available in your country."

 

 

The devices are in the US. Location services confirms this, the external device IP is also US based as well. I have cleared cache and app storage of Google Play and Google Play Services. I have upgraded Google Play Services. 

 

The devices are fully managed with manage service accounts. I have reset the account assigned to the device. 

I have tried to set the Country manually in Google Play setting but am unable to do so. It does not show a current country. I also see an option for "Switch to the United States Play Store" but tapping on it doesn't do anything. 

 

Any ideas or suggestions here?

Just some questions to clarify things:

  1. Ensure on a consumer device, if app is available in the US.
  2. Turn Wifi off, put SIM card into the device and reboot it, then try again.
    • Does this work?
      • If yes, there's something on the Wifi (like proxy) telling the device the wrong country.
  3. Does the Wifi you are connected to, use a proxy which maybe is not located in the US?
    • If yes, you need to do "2." (or connect (temporarily) to a Wifi without a proxy instead of the SIM)
  4. Ensure (i guess not, as no key icon visible) the device doesn't use a VPN to somewhere outside of the US. Otherwise turn it off, reboot and try again.
